Obituary for John A. Woosnam

John A.  Woosnam
John A. Woosnam went to heaven peacefully on Wed. May 6, 2020. He was 74. John was the beloved son of Mary (Gallagher) and Francis Woosnam. He is survived by his children, John (Nicole) and Maria Gerken (Jim); grandchildren, Christopher, Luke, Joseph, Ryan, Sean, Trey, Sophia, Gianna and Ella; and his sister, Maureen Woosnam. He is preceded in death by his son, Anthony and brothers; Francis (Hank), Robert, and William. He was loved and will be sorely missed by a countless number of friends.

John was a proud USMC Veteran and a draftsman by trade employed by Philco Ford, NARCO and General Electric. Thankfully, he enjoyed many years of retirement.

Due to the Covid 19 pandemic, John's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ated privately. He will be laid to rest in Resurrection Cemetery in Bensalem. John would be very proud if we requested donations in his memory that would benefit military families. Accordingly, the Woosnam family has selected The Fisher House Foundation, 12300 Twinbrook Parkway, Suite 410, Rockville, ND 20852; or via https://fisherhouse.org.
